1 JISC IE Metadata Schema Registry Technical Update 23 November 2004 Dave Beckett.

Slides:



Advertisements
Similar presentations
OAI from 50,000 Feet OAI develops and promotes interoperability solutions that aim to facilitate the efficient dissemination of content. Begun in 1999.
Advertisements

A centre of expertise in digital information management The OAI Protocol for Metadata Harvesting Andy Powell UKOLN,
Technical Highlights 25th August 2011 Sebastian Peters German National Library of Science and Technology.
DC2001, Tokyo DCMI Registry : Background and demonstration DC2001 Tokyo October 2001 Rachel Heery, UKOLN, University of Bath Harry Wagner, OCLC
DCMI Workshop on Metadata and Search Vendor Panel Presentation Bradley P. Allen
Copyright, UCL LEADERS: Linking EAD to Electronically Retrievable Sources Developing a Generic Toolkit: Architecture and technology issues ALLC/ACH Conference.
A centre of expertise in digital information management UKOLN is supported by: The JISC IE Metadata Schema Registry British Library, Boston.
Ontology Servers and Metadata Vocabulary Repositories Dr. Manjula Patel Technical Research and Development
UKOLN is supported by: The JISC Information Environment Bath Profile Four Years On: whats being done in the UK? 7 th July 2003 Andy Powell, UKOLN, University.
UKOLN is supported by: The JISC Information Environment Metadata Schema Registry (IEMSR): Update DC-2006, Manzanillo, Mexico October 3-6, 2006 Rachel Heery.
February Harvesting RDF metadata Building digital library portals with harvested metadata workshop EU-DL All Projects concertation meeting DELOS.
EMu New Features 2013 Bernard Marshall KE Software.
JISC IE Architecture external trends and their potential impact Andy Powell UKOLN, University of Bath
Update on the SWORD Protocol & Future Directions.
The Knowledge Management Research Group 1 Towards an Interoperability Framework for Metadata Standards Presenter: Mikael Nilsson Co-authors: Pete Johnston.
A Middleware Registry for the Discovery of Collections and Services Ann Apps MIMAS, The University of Manchester, UK.
The JISC IE Metadata Schema Registry Pete Johnston UKOLN, University of Bath JISC Joint Programmes Meeting Brighton, 6-7 July 2004
Digital Video Archiving. ViArchive Overview ViArchive provides user friendly solutions for… – uploading video clips with metadata (searchable file info.
1 Introduction to XML. XML eXtensible implies that users define tag content Markup implies it is a coded document Language implies it is a metalanguage.
© 2007 IBM Corporation IBM Emerging Technologies Enabling an Accessible Web 2.0 Becky Gibson Web Accessibility Architect.
SKOS and Other W3C Vocabulary Related Activities Gail Hodge Information International Assoc. NKOS Workshop Denver, CO June 10, 2005.
Michael Donovan, River Campus Libraries – 12/03 DocuShare Overview and Training.
Z39.50, XML & RDF Applications ZIG Tutorial January 2000 Poul Henrik Jørgensen, Danish Bibliographic Centre,
The NERC DataGrid Vocabulary Server Roy Lowry British Oceanographic Data Centre Ontology Registry Meeting.
RDF Data Sources (keyword textbox) Search RDF Data Sources: LOM Binding Schemas (keyword textbox) Search XML Bindings: Dublin Core Application Profiles.
Metadata Schema Registries: update on current activity Rachel Heery, UKOLN, University of Bath September 2005.
T Network Application Frameworks and XML Web Services and WSDL Sasu Tarkoma Based on slides by Pekka Nikander.
Using IESR Ann Apps MIMAS, The University of Manchester, UK.
Max Planck Institute for Psycholinguistics Tool development report H. Brugman MPI Nijmegen.
UDDI ebXML(?) and such Essential Web Services Directory and Discovery.
A centre of expertise in digital information management The MEG Metadata Schemas Registry Pete Johnston, Research Officer (Interoperability),
A centre of expertise in digital information management UKOLN is supported by: The JISC IE Metadata Schema Registry & Metadata Application.
National Center for Supercomputing Applications NCSA OPIE Presentation November 2000.
The JISC IE Metadata Schema Registry and IEEE LOM Application Profiles Pete Johnston UKOLN, University of Bath CETIS Metadata & Digital Repositories SIG,
9 th Open Forum on Metadata Registries Harmonization of Terminology, Ontology and Metadata 20th – 22nd March, 2006, Kobe Japan. Presentation Title: Day:
UKOLN is supported by: The JISC Information Environment Metadata Schema Registry (IEMSR) Open Forum on Metadata Registries 2005 Rachel Heery Assistant.
Dublin Core Metadata Schema Registry at Tsukuba Shigeo Sugimoto, Mitsuharu Nagamori Graduate School of Library, Information and Media Studies University.
The MEG Metadata Schemas Registry: Architecture & Data Model MEG Registry Workshop, Bath, 21 January 2003 Pete Johnston UKOLN, University of Bath Bath,
Metadata Schema Registries in the Partially Semantic Web: the CORES experience Rachel Heery, Pete Johnston, UKOLN, University of.
Copyright © by Shayne R Flint Simplified Web Application Development Shayne R Flint Department of Computer Science Australian National University.
A centre of expertise in digital information management UKOLN is supported by: Metadata Schema Registries, Metadata Application Profiles,
JISC Information Environment Service Registry (IESR) Ann Apps MIMAS, The University of Manchester, UK.
Metadata Registries Registry: authoritative, centrally controlled store of information – W3C Web Services Glossary, 2004
Supporting further and higher education The JISC Information Environment Programmes Alan Robiette, JISC Development Group.
An Introduction to Web Services Web Services using Java / Session 1 / 2 of 21 Objectives Discuss distributed computing Explain web services and their.
Shell Interface Shell Interface Functions Data. Graphical Interface Graphical Interface Command-line Interface Command-line Interface Experiments Private.
DSpace System Architecture 11 July 2002 DSpace System Architecture.
IESR Metadata Ann Apps MIMAS, The University of Manchester, UK.
Web-Based Inventory Database Application By: Gar Seigla.
Differences and distinctions: metadata types and their uses Stephen Winch Information Architecture Officer, SLIC.
IESR, A Registry of Collections and Services: Using the DCMI Collection Description Profile in Practice Ann Apps MIMAS, The University of Manchester, UK.
The JISC Information Environment Service Registry (IESR) Ann Apps Mimas, The University of Manchester, UK.
The NSDL, OAI and Your Metadata Core Infrastructure Metadata Repository (“union catalog”) Naomi Dushay Cornell University.
A centre of expertise in digital information management UKOLN is supported by: IEMSR, the Information Environment & Metadata Application.
INFSO-RI Enabling Grids for E-sciencE BAR: The Current Status Charaka Palansuriya EPCC.
XML 2002 Annotation Management in an XML CMS A Case Study.
Extended Metadata Registries and Semantics (Part 2: Implementation) Karlo Berket Ecoterm IV Environmental Terminology Workshop April 18, 2007 Diplomatic.
Metadata Schema Registries: background and context MEG Registry Workshop, Bath, 21 January 2003 Rachel Heery UKOLN, University of Bath Bath, BA2 7AY UKOLN.
Introduction to Control System Studio (CSS) Kay Kasemir, Kunal Shroff EPICS Fall Collaboration Meeting, October 2011 PSI.
CMF For Content Authors. Slide 1©2001 Zope Corporation. All Rights Reserved. Outline Understand CMF approach to content Demonstrate content author goals.
XML Related Technologies
T Network Application Frameworks and XML Web Services and WSDL Sasu Tarkoma Based on slides by Pekka Nikander.
The JISC IE Metadata Schema Registry
The JISC IE Metadata Schema Registry
IEMSR Em Tonkin & Andrew Hewson
Session 2: Metadata and Catalogues
JISC Information Environment Service Registry (IESR)
Bubba Lyrics A Data Driven Music Website
CREE: HEIRPORT lite Welcome screen:
Presentation transcript:

1 JISC IE Metadata Schema Registry Technical Update 23 November 2004 Dave Beckett

2 Overview Server and prototype walkthrough MEG client and problems Client Changes Walkthrough of client Technical status

3 Dublin Core AP Terminology Metadata Vocabularies DC Elements [RDF Properties] DC Encoding Schemes [RDF Classes]

4 LOM AP Terminology LOM Data Elements –Simple –“Root” LOM Vocabularies –LOM (in the LOM standard) –Non-LOM (elsewhere) LOM Data Types

5 Prototype Server Contents IEMSR model for DC and LOM LOM: IEEE LOM, UK LOM Core AP DC: 3 DC APs, 7 vocabularies

6 MSR Prototype Server Demonstration

7 Server Prototype Issues No authentication No protocol updates Web interface hard-coded No user manipulation of results However… easy to hack

8 Future server work Technologies (Java +) Protocols and standards –HTTP (#1) –SPARQL for RDF to/from client –SRW, SRU, OAI, SOAP, … ??? Web site –Driven from server –Apache Velocity ???

9 MEG client ( )

10 MEG client problems Usability –Unfamiliar model (drag and drop) –Multiple windows Aesthetics –Ugly Technical –Hard to improve with Java and Swing

11 MEG client updates needed Better modelling –After MEG, CORES, evolving best practice RDF standardisation –2004 RDF specs Protocol standardisation –SOAP, WSDL, OAI, SRW, SRU, SPARQL (sorry for the acronym soup)

12 Technology changes Replace Swing with SWT –OS native look and feel –Better looking User Interface Application operation changed to better match OS norms –Removed drag and drop –Single window

13 Process changes Open Source using SourceForge Multiple developers Use an experienced desktop application developer to refactor the application Early work focusing on client

14 Important model changes for client MEG client: DC AP IEMSR client: DC AP and LOM AP +Modelling documents +Authentication +Moving to standardised service APIs +JISC IE requirements

15 Client Walkthrough Screenshots of current code Some are mocked up UI

16 Client Startup – Create Agency

17 Loading an existing AP

18 Two client modes DC AP – building a set of property usages LOM AP – selecting from a tree of data elements

19 Create a new AP

20 Dublin Core AP in the Client Building an AP from empty OR from an existing AP Adding DC elements / Properties Making Property Usages

21 DC AP Profile properties

22 DC AP Search for “title”

23 LOM AP in the Client Start from an existing AP: a sub-tree of the LOM Refine / narrow what is allowed Add requirements: mandatory, size Edit, add vocabularies [Later: Adding extension data elements]

24 LOM AP search for “description”

25 Current client state Interface / model code separated Not yet fully re-attached Vocabulary updated for IEMSR DCAP working soon LOMAP model code is new LOMAP UI is new Running on Windows, OSX, Linux

26 Client and Server timelines ClientServer MSR client MSR server (new code in Java) MEG client MSR prototype server (MEG server updated) MEG server (existing code in Perl) MSR client MEG model MSR model MSR model + new protocols Feb 2005 Nov 2004 Web site

27 Client and Server Summary Browsing and searching – both Browsing – much better on web Editing – only in client